The Rutherford GO Station is a train and bus station in the GO Transit network located in Vaughan, Ontario, Canada. It is a stop on the Bradford line train service. This station was opened on January, 2001 to accommodate the growing ridership on the Bradford Line along with the growing communities surrounding Rutherford GO Station.
Rutherford is a small lunar impact crater that lies on the Moon's far side. It is located just to the north-northwest of the huge Mendeleev walled-plain. To the east of Rutherford is the equally diminutive Glauber crater, and to the west-northwest lies Hoffmeister crater.

The rutherford (symbol Rd) is an obsolete unit of radioactivity, defined as the activity of a quantity of radioactive material in which one million nuclei decay per second. It is therefore equivalent to 1 MBq.
